This option will perform year-end processing for you. It will balance all the income/expense accounts transferring the balance of each account to the retained earnings or retained income account.
|
|
This account will then show your net profit or loss for the year. The balances of the balance sheet accounts are brought forward to the New year. |
The reporting dates are updated to cater for the New Year. Once the year-end procedure is completed, you will be able to post transactions to your new financial year.
|
|
osFinancials stores the transactions and balances for accounts for up to two financial years (This Year and Last Year). You will still be able to view the transactions and reports for the previous closed financial year. |

It is recommended that you Disable your Screen Saver in the Windows Operating System, before starting this process. This will prevent the Screen Saver being activated while the process is running. |
To do a year end:
- On the Setup ribbon, select Do year end. The following information screen is displayed:

- If you are absolutely sure, tick the "I have read this instruction and understand the action!" field. The Yes and No buttons will be available on this screen.

|
|
If you have not made backups, click on the No button and backup your Set of Books. |
- If you click on the Yes button, a confirmation message is displayed:

- Click on the Yes button, if you are absolutely sure you have made backups.
|
|
This is your last chance to cancel this process. If you want to abort the process, click on the Yes button. |
- Click on the No button to start the process.
|
|
It is recommended that you do not use your system for other tasks while this process is running. |
- Once the process is finished, the confirmation message is displayed:

- Click on the OK button. You may continue to work in the new year.
Post to last year
- It is possible to post transactions in batches (journals) and/or documents (invoices, credit notes, purchases and supplier returns) to the previous financial year. For example, if transactions in a batch includes a date that corresponds to the previous financial year (for instance, if the current financial year spans from 01/03/2022 to 28/02/2023 and the transaction date is 10/03/2021), a confirmation message will appear asking if you want to proceed with posting the batch. The message will state:
"Do you want to continue posting? Batch contains transactions posting to last year!"
- Check that the date is correct - Last year's date.
- Click on the Yes button. osFinancials will post the transaction to the previous (last) financial year.
If the date(s) of the transactions is incorrect:
- Click on the No button.
- Correct the date(s) of the transaction in the batch to this year.
- Balance the batch once again.
- Post the batch.
|
|
It is also a good idea to restrict posting to the previous financial year. You may do this by selecting (Setup ribbon) Setup → Reporting dates and remove the tick in the "Post to last year" field. Although you will not be able to post transactions to that financial year, you may still print reports. You may at any time select this field again should you wish to post to the previous financial year. |
